I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

inserer heure début et heure fin dans une requete


Sujet :

Requêtes et SQL.

  1. #1
    Membre actif
    Inscrit en
    Avril 2007
    Messages
    1 241
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 1 241
    Points : 213
    Points
    213
    Par défaut inserer heure début et heure fin dans une requete
    Bonjour,
    Je travaille actuellement sur des tables définies.
    je souhaite crée une requete qui me donnerait des données entre deux heures : H-1heure et heure H.

    Le champ "heure" s'intitule "EventTime"
    sur ma requete j'ai inseré deux fois ce champ de la manière suivante:

    début :EventTime
    sur la ligne critère , j'ai insere la mention Fin :EventTime
    sur la ligne critère , j'ai insere la mention Lorque je lance la requete, le champ "fin" me donne la même heure que le champ "début".
    Alors que je voudrais par exemple que le champ fin =15:00 et le champ début =14:00.

    Je ne parviens pas à resoudre ce problème.
    Un coup de main serait le bienvenu.
    Merci d'avance

    PS : je ne connais pas le language SQL...

    J'oubliais , aprés la création de cette requete , je créerais un formulaire.

  2. #2
    Membre averti Avatar de Vince
    Profil pro
    Inscrit en
    Mars 2002
    Messages
    369
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2002
    Messages : 369
    Points : 366
    Points
    366
    Par défaut
    Exemple pour retirer 1h à now :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    Dim dtNowMoins1h As Date
    dtNowMoins1h = DateAdd("h", -1, Now)
    (DateAdd() sur MSDN)


    Dans ton cas je stockerai seulement la valeur de Now dans la base, le Now - 1h serai calculé à chaque accès à un enregistrement à partir du champ "contenant Now".

  3. #3
    Rédacteur/Modérateur

    Avatar de User
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Août 2004
    Messages
    8 424
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Août 2004
    Messages : 8 424
    Points : 20 002
    Points
    20 002
    Billets dans le blog
    67
    Par défaut
    Salut,

    Pour les critères:

    EventTime
    sur la ligne critère :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Entre (Maintenant()-1/24) et Maintenant()
    ou encore comme suggéré par Vince:

    EventTime
    sur la ligne critère :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    between DateAdd("h", -1, Now) and Now


    Après pour l'affichage:

    Début: Maintenant()-1/24

    Fin:Maintenant()

    A+

  4. #4
    Membre actif
    Inscrit en
    Avril 2007
    Messages
    1 241
    Détails du profil
    Informations forums :
    Inscription : Avril 2007
    Messages : 1 241
    Points : 213
    Points
    213
    Par défaut
    Bonjour Vince et User,
    merci pour vos réponses mais je me suis peut etre mal exprimé.
    Ce que je souhaite c'est qu' a partir du champ "EventTime" avec le critère
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Entre (Maintenant()-1/24) et Maintenant()
    je puisse avoir dans ma requete deux champs dont l'un s'intitulerait "début" avec le critère
    et le deuxième champ s'intitulerait "fin" avec le critère

Discussions similaires

  1. Réponses: 2
    Dernier message: 13/01/2015, 09h56
  2. Réponses: 0
    Dernier message: 05/10/2010, 12h37
  3. Réponses: 1
    Dernier message: 14/05/2007, 04h08
  4. INSERER DU TEXTE AVEC DES CHAMPS DANS UNE REQUETE SUR sql Srv 2000
    Par sauceaupistou d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 24/03/2007, 11h02
  5. probleme format heure dans une requete
    Par adenov dans le forum Requêtes et SQL.
    Réponses: 5
    Dernier message: 14/03/2007, 13h26

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o